How to process only new line of tail -f command from live log file?
Hi,
I want to read a live log file line by line and considering those line which are newly added to file Below code I am using, which read line but as soon as it read new line from log file its starts processing from very first line of file.
Code:
tail -F /logs/COMMON-ERROR.log | while read myline; do
ERROR_CODE=$(echo $ myline | awk -F ' ' '{for (i=1;i<=NF;i++){if($i ~ "^[1-1]" && length($i)==6){print $i}}}')
ERROR_CODE_DET=$(echo $ myline | awk -F ' ' '{print $1" "$2}')
echo "$ERROR_CODE_DET" "$ERROR_CODE"
if [ "$ERROR_CODE" -eq 100021 ] ; then
ERROR_MSG="Route failed. Moving to failed routes pool."
fi
done
Last edited by vbe; 10-17-2013 at 10:50 AM..
Reason: code tags + rm fancy fonts...
HI i have to copy the last 5000 lines form a log file and copy the same in the same file .overwriting the same log file.
ex: tail -5000 testfile1 > testfile2
cat testfile2
mv tesftfile2 testfile1
will produce the correct result.but i want to have this done in one line???? (4 Replies)
I have a log file that is about 1.2 million lines long and about 300MB.
we need a way to clean up this file and only keep the last few thousand lines.
if i use tail command we run our of memory as the file is too big.
I do have a key word to match on.
example, we want to keep every line... (8 Replies)
I don't quite know what I'm doing, so this simple script is proving a challenge.
Here is some pseudo code that doesn't work yet:
if tail -1 "WORKING.txt" >/dev/null | egrep "^NMBR=*" > /dev/null
then
curl -k 'http://www.myserver.com/log.cgi?input=$?'
echo "hi there"
fi
Purpose:... (3 Replies)
Hi ,
1)i want to display specific line number using tail command.
e.g. display 10 line from end.
Please help...
2)Want to display line 10 to 15 (from end)using tail command) (2 Replies)
Greetings, I'm new to this forum, also new to shell script
I have done some simple shell script before, like backup linux machine using rsync and crontab, but now I need to do some log analyzing, which is beyond my ability... so I'm going to seek for help in this forum, hope someone could give... (5 Replies)
Hello Guys,
I have created function which is as follow:
tail -f filename |grep "Key word"
output from this command
19-11-2011 21:09:15,234 - INFO Numbement - error number:result = :11
19-11-2011 21:09:15,286 - INFO Numbement - error number:result = :11
19-11-2011 21:09:15,523 - INFO... (5 Replies)
Hi,
I want to read a live log file line by line and considering those line which start from time stamp;
Below code I am using, which read line but throws an exception when comparing line that does not contain error code
tail -F /logs/COMMON-ERROR.log | while read myline; do... (2 Replies)
Hello,
I have been working on script which need to generate an alert based upon live logs. If string is found then an alert mail must triggered.
tail -n -0 -F works fine to redirect the each latest line from live logs file to grep a pattern for matching but it seems to be not working on... (7 Replies)
First month learning about the Linux terminal and it has been a challenge yet fun so far. We're learning by using a gameshell. I'm trying to display a certain line ( only allowed 1 command ) from a file only using the head or tail. I'm pretty about this answer:
head -23 history.txt | tail -1... (1 Reply)
Discussion started by: forzatekk
1 Replies
LEARN ABOUT DEBIAN
mdbfontsize
mdbFontSize(5) The m17n Library mdbFontSize(5)NAME
mdbFontSize - Font Size
DESCRIPTION
In some case, a font contains incorrect information about its size (typically in the case of a hacked TrueType font), which results in a
bad text layout when such a font is used in combination with the other fonts. To overcome this problem, the m17n library loads information
about font-size adjustment from the m17n database by the tags <font, resize>. The data is loaded as a plist of this format.
FONT-SIZE-ADJUSTMENT ::= PER-FONT *
PER-FONT ::= '(' FONT-SPEC ADJUST-RATIO ')'
FONT-SPEC ::=
'(' [ FOUNDRY FAMILY
[ WEIGHT [ STYLE [ STRETCH [ ADSTYLE ]]]]]
REGISTRY ')'
ADJUST-RATIO ::= INTEGER
FONT-SPEC is to specify properties of a font. FOUNDRY to REGISTRY are symbols corresponding to Mfoundry to Mregistry property of a font.
See m17nFont for the meaning of each property.
ADJUST-RATIO is an integer number specifying by percentage how much the font-size must be adjusted. For instance, this PER-FONT:
((devanagari-cdac) 150)
instructs the font handler of the m17n library to open a font of 1.5 times bigger than a requested size on opening a font whose registry is
'devanagari-cdac'.
COPYRIGHT
Copyright (C) 2001 Information-technology Promotion Agency (IPA)
Copyright (C) 2001-2011 National Institute of Advanced Industrial Science and Technology (AIST)
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License
<http://www.gnu.org/licenses/fdl.html>.
Version 1.6.2 12 Jan 2011 mdbFontSize(5)